Hourly Paid Lecturer in Travel and Tourism

London, Greater London

£32.27 (including holiday pay) – Tutor Rate £38.23 per hour, Teaching Rate £24.72 per hour. Fixed‑term contract.

United Colleges Group (UCG) – a London‑based education group with a turnover of £50m.

The Faculty of Health, Wellbeing & Care is looking for a suitably qualified and experienced Lecturer in Travel and Tourism. The role will involve tutoring and course management of a Level 1, 2 or 3 vocational programme as well as teaching across all programmes.

Responsibilities
  • Tutor and manage Level 1–3 vocational programmes.
  • Teach across all programmes.
Qualifications
  • Degree (or equivalent) in a related area with relevant experience within the Travel & Tourism industry.
  • Familiarity with the current NCFE curriculum.
  • Recognised Level 4 teaching qualification (PGCE/Cert Ed) or willingness to work towards a Level 5 teaching qualification upon appointment.
Skills & Attributes
  • Sound organisational skills.
  • Ability to work cooperatively and contribute positively and creatively to a team.
  • Excellent communication, administration and interpersonal skills.
Benefits

Generous annual leave, defined‑benefit pension scheme, interest‑free season ticket loan, cycle scheme, free sight tests, enhanced maternity and paternity leave schemes and many other benefits.
